Ahmed Harun, the governor of Sudan's Southern Kordofan, has been filmed addressing troops before a battle with rebel fighters urging them to "take no prisoners".

He apparently condones war crimes in orders to the Sudanese army.

Rabi Abdel Atti, a senior adviser to Sudan's information ministry, spoke to Al Jazeera about the video footage, saying Harun's comments were "not interpreted correctly".
